About BRIDGES HULL LTD
BRIDGES HULL LTD is a registered charity in England and Wales (registration number 1123951). Based on official Charity Commission data, it holds a "Verified" rating with a CharityScore of 80/100 — a well-rated and transparent charity that meets strong governance standards. This indicates a reliable charity with strong fundamentals across most of our assessment criteria. In its most recent reporting year (2024), BRIDGES HULL LTD reported a total income of £96,035 and total expenditure of £98,322, a spending ratio of 102% which is broadly in line with its income. According to the Charity Commission register, BRIDGES HULL LTD describes its activities as follows: The charity aims to help disengaged / disaffected young people in the Bransholme area of Hull. It does this by developing positive relationships with them and engaging them in a broad range of social and educational activities. Our analysis found no significant governance concerns for BRIDGES HULL LTD. No regulatory actions, filing failures, or financial anomalies were detected in the available public data.
